Simple French Toast Casserole
I have another, fancier version of French Toast Casserole that I make occasionally, but this is a simpler, cheaper version that we also like.
Ingredients
- 2 loaves French bread, cut into 1-inch cubes
- 8 large eggs
- 3 cups milk
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
- 1/4 cup granulated sugar
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
Topping
- 1/2 cup margarine, cold and cut into small pieces
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
Directions
- Grease 12x18 inch roasting pan.
- In a large bowl, whisk together eggs, milk, vanilla, 1/4 cup sugar, salt, and nutmeg. Pour over bread. Press bread down gently with a spatula to soak all bread. Cover and refrigerate overnight.
- Preheat oven to 350°F.
- Remove casserole from refrigerator. Dot top with pieces of margarine.
- In a small bowl, mix together 1/2 cup sugar and cinnamon. Sprinkle evenly over top of casserole.
- Bake uncovered for 45 minutes, or until top is golden and center is set. Let stand for 10 minutes to cool slightly.
- Serve warm with additional syrup.
